Why ThinkPad? (also applies to other business laptops)
>They’re really cheap when you buy a used one.
>Keyboards feel excellent while typing (yes, even the newer ones).
>Great durability thanks to the inclusion of rollcages and use of glass fiber reinforced plastic for the chassis. The keyboard is splash proof and spilled liquids will drain out.
>Utilitarian design - e.g. indicator LEDs, 7 row keyboard layout on older models.
>Docking solutions that easily turns your laptop into a desktop.
>Easy to repair, upgrade and maintain thanks to readily available service manuals for almost every model. Spare parts are easy and cheap to obtain.
>The best trackpoint (that red thing on the middle of the keyboard). Great for those who type a lot or hate swiping their fingers all over a touchpad.
>Excellent GNU/Linux & *BSD support.

New to thinkpad laptops. What can the expansion ports and slots be used for?

>>52302948
Depends on which ones
mSATA -> mSATA SSD
Expresscard - things like IC card readers, external graphics cards and USB 3.0 ports
As for the internal slots like the mPCIe -> there's a whitelist for wireless cards et al so you're kinda restricted on that unless you're willing to use a BIOS mod if available

Are slimline models any worse than the originals?
>>
>>52313232
Generally speaking they are. You trade battery life, thermals, and serviceability/upgradability for somewhat reduced weight and thickness. It doesn't matter so much with the newer ones where the "original" models are ultrabook crap anyway, but for T420s vs T420 it's not even a competition to me, and I've used both machines. Only reason I'd go for a T420s is if I couldn't find a regular T420 with the 1600x900 screen, since the -s variant always has it.
